Ben McCorkle is Professor of English at The Ohio State University, teaching composition, rhetoric and digital media studies. His research examines the historical intersections between communication technologies and rhetorical practices.
Education credentials:
- Ph.D. from The Ohio State University (2005)
- M.A. from The Ohio State University (2000)
- B.A. from Augusta State University (1996)
McCorkle's scholarship investigates how technological innovations from classical times to digital interfaces have transformed rhetorical delivery. He co-directs the Digital Archive of Literacy Narratives, preserving personal accounts of literacy development. Recent publications analyze pedagogical approaches to new media across historical periods.
His courses include digital media production, writing instruction, and communication theory.
